Hi all,

Im trying to port a win ce 6.0 bootloader to an ARM 11 based
platform. I`ve cloned an OMAP based BSP and have made a few changes in
the StartUp function and I can build a binary from the same. When i
disassemble the .exe and compare with the .bin I see similar code in
the .bin from offset 0x4E. For some reason the StartUp code is not
from the start of the .bin file and is misaligned. I would need my
startup code to be at the start of the binary file so that once
written into flash the processer starts executing from the first
instruction in the startup func. Is there any way to align / force the
startup code.
Any help on this would be greatly appreciated.